Mohammad in the Bible

 

After Prophet Jesus (peace be upon him) told the Jews, who stand against Jesus the Christ and all God prophets sent to them before him, that after him no prophet will appear among them and that the kingdom of God would be taken away from them and given to a nation more worthy of it, meaning thereby that the children of Ishmael, whom they (the children of Israel) had rejected and disowned, had been chosen by God for his great blessings.

 

" I have yet many things to say unto you, but ye cannot bear them now. Howbeit when he, the spirit of truth, is come, he will guide you into all truth"                                         (John 16:12, 13)

 

In a non-canonical Gospel, the Gospel of St. Bernabas, Jesus mentioned the spirit of truth or the comforter – the Prophet who was to come after him to guide the world " into all the truth" – by name thus:

" Then said the Priest, 'How shall the comforter be called, and what signs shall reveal his coming?' Jesus answered, 'The name of the comforter is Admirable, for God gave him the name when he had created his soul, and placed it in Celestial Splendor. God said, ' Wait Mohammad, for the sake I will create paradise the world, and a great multitude of creatures, whereof I make thee a present, in so much that who shall bless thee shall be blessed, and who so shall curse thee shall be cursed. When I shall send thee into the world, I shall send thee as My Messenger of salvation, and thy word shall be true, in so much that heaven and earth shall fail, but thy faith shall never fail.' Mohammed is his blessed name. Then the crowd lifted up their voice saying: 'O God, send us Thy Messenger. O! Mohammed, come quickly for the salvation of the world." (1)

 

(1) The Gospel of St. Bernabas edited and translated from a Manuscript in the Imperial Library at Vienna by Lousdale and Laura Ragg, Oxford.
